[Asia Economy Reporter Park Hyesook] The Incheon Free Economic Zone Authority is re-announcing a bid for a developer to create a medical complex town with a general hospital of over 500 beds in Cheongna International City.


This project was previously canceled last March as no companies submitted proposals in the first call for bids.


The Incheon Free Economic Zone Authority plans to accept proposals until May 28 for this re-bid, conduct evaluations according to the bidding guidelines, and select a preferred negotiation partner by July.


The Cheongna Medical Complex Town will be developed on a 261,635㎡ site in 601, 1 Cheongna-dong, Seo-gu, Incheon, including a general hospital with over 500 beds, medical bio-related industry-academia-research facilities, office spaces, and retail facilities.


To reduce the financial burden of establishing medical facilities, the Incheon Free Economic Zone Authority will supply land at approximately 2.5 million KRW per 3.3㎡ and mandate that the resulting development profits be reinvested into industrial facility sites and general hospitals.


Additionally, 3,000 officetel units for employees of the medical complex town are permitted, and lifestyle accommodation facilities combining hotels and hospitals called "Meditel" with 700 units are allowed; however, individual unit sales of these accommodations will not be permitted.


Considering the large scale of this project and the longer time required for architectural design of general hospitals compared to other facilities, some conditions have been adjusted to allow flexibility in the project schedule.



An official from the Incheon Free Economic Zone Authority stated, "This year, we will do our best to ensure the project proceeds normally by selecting a preferred negotiation partner for the Cheongna Medical Complex Town and signing a business agreement."
